How Green Manufacturing Technologies Are Helping Reduce the Energy Consumption of Factories
Green manufacturing technologies are revolutionizing the industrial sector by significantly reducing energy consumption in factories. As industries strive for sustainability, these innovative solutions play a crucial role in minimizing the environmental impact of production processes.
One of the key aspects of green manufacturing is the incorporation of energy-efficient machinery and systems. Modern manufacturing equipment is designed to consume less power while maintaining operational efficiency. For instance, the use of advanced motors and variable frequency drives (VFDs) enables factories to optimize energy use based on real-time demands, thus reducing unnecessary energy waste.
Additionally, the integration of automation and robotics in manufacturing processes enhances efficiency. Automated systems can operate with precision, reducing errors and waste, which in turn lowers energy consumption. Smart factories utilize data analytics and IoT technologies to monitor energy usage continuously, allowing for real-time adjustments that maximize efficiency.
Renewable energy sources also play a significant role in green manufacturing. Factories increasingly harness solar panels, wind turbines, and geothermal systems, which not only reduce reliance on fossil fuels but also lower overall operational costs. This shift towards renewable energy sources provides a dual benefit: it cuts energy expenses and minimizes carbon footprints.
Waste heat recovery systems are another innovative technology making waves in energy savings. These systems capture excess heat generated during manufacturing processes and repurpose it for heating or power generation. This not only conserves energy but also enhances overall production efficiency.
Implementing sustainable practices, such as lean manufacturing principles, further contributes to energy reduction. Lean manufacturing focuses on minimizing waste, including energy waste, by streamlining processes. By eliminating non-value-added activities, factories can operate more efficiently, translating to less energy consumption.
Employee engagement in sustainability initiatives is essential as well. Training staff on energy-efficient practices and involving them in decision-making can lead to creative solutions for reducing energy use. Empowering employees to contribute to energy conservation efforts fosters a culture of sustainability within the organization.
